It contained all the gear required to create and test a working circuit board that is the students\u2019 final class project.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p>\u201cI\u2019m a pretty hands-on engineer,\u201d says Heines. \u201cI learn best by being able to apply things going on in the classroom or in lectures. So this was very exciting.\u201d<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p>Juan Ramirez, a senior staffer at the <a href=\"https:\/\/www.jhuapl.edu\/\" target=\"_blank\" rel=\"noreferrer noopener\">Applied Physics Laboratory<\/a>, teaches the course. (He won a 2023 faculty award for designing it.) He notes that each box contains an assortment of different electrical components\u2014including a resistor, capacitor, and magnetic cores.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p>\u201cEnough is provided that they can go ahead and build the circuit to whatever their design is,\u201d says Ramirez. \u201cThey wind their own magnetics. No two students will have the same exact transformer, because they\u2019re designing their own.\u201d<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p>Northrop Grumman engineer David Clancy took the course in spring 2025 as part of his work toward a master\u2019s degree through the EP program. He says that the box\u2014and his sense of accomplishment in assembling its contents\u2014\u201cis something I didn\u2019t get with any other course I have taken.\u201d<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p>Ramirez says that even though his course is fully remote, like all EP offerings, it\u2019s important to him to offer a hands-on component. \u201cA lot of students go through their undergraduate education in electrical engineering and maybe never get the opportunity to learn how to solder electrical components onto a circuit board,\u201d he says. \u201cThey have that opportunity in this course. We send them a solder station in the box.\u201d<br><\/p>\n\n\n\n<blockquote class=\"wp-block-quote is-layout-flow wp-block-quote-is-layout-flow\">\n<div class=\"wp-block-group is-nowrap is-layout-flex wp-container-core-group-is-layout-ad2f72ca wp-block-group-is-layout-flex\">\n<img loading=\"lazy\" decoding=\"async\" width=\"150\" height=\"150\" class=\"gb-media-a266ea87\" alt=\"\" src=\"https:\/\/engineering.jhu.edu\/magazine\/wp-content\/uploads\/2025\/11\/Ramirez-150x150.png\" title=\"Ramirez\" srcset=\"https:\/\/engineering.jhu.edu\/magazine\/wp-content\/uploads\/2025\/11\/Ramirez-150x150.png 150w, https:\/\/engineering.jhu.edu\/magazine\/wp-content\/uploads\/2025\/11\/Ramirez-300x300.png 300w, https:\/\/engineering.jhu.edu\/magazine\/wp-content\/uploads\/2025\/11\/Ramirez.png 591w\" sizes=\"auto, (max-width: 150px) 100vw, 150px\" \/>\n\n\n\n<p>\u201cA lot of students go through their undergraduate education in electrical engineering and maybe never get the opportunity to learn how to solder electrical components onto a circuit board. Yet Ramirez\u2019s course took shape in response to students\u2019 desire to put the learning acquired in prerequisite courses into direct practice.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p>\u201cWhen I was starting my work in industry, and even being involved with recruitment and mentorship as I was progressing in my career, I was continuing to see this same discussion about the gap between the fundamentals that we learn in school and how to actually apply them,\u201d Ramirez says.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p>Dan Horn, A&amp;S \u201992 associate vice dean for professional education and lifelong learning at the Whiting School, says that finding and filling these gaps is the center of the EP enterprise. \u201cThe program chairs do a magnificent job of surveying industry, identifying critical needs, and building coursework to help Engineering for Professionals students meet those needs,\u201d he observes.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p>Existing program faculty are the engine for EP offerings, continues Horn, \u201cbut if we don\u2019t have someone who can teach a particular course in a new area, we recruit an expert in the field to develop and deliver that course. What sets EP apart from our peers is that our faculty are in roles to which students aspire.\u201d Instructors for the EP program have been drawn from AT&amp;T, KBR, and the U.S. Army Research Laboratory to teach courses in areas such as Generative AI for Cybersecurity, Advanced Concepts in Agile Technical Management, and RF Power Amplifier Design Techniques.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p>The skills developed by EP students boost their career trajectories as well. Clancy is close to finishing his master\u2019s degree with support from Northrop Grumman. He adds that a course like Applications of Electrical Power Design \u201callows me to essentially have a practice run before I have to go do it in my professional career. I made all the mistakes when it didn\u2019t really matter\u2026. Now I have the knowledge to just build something, test it, and capture my own data.\u201d<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p>Satisfaction with EP offerings is a two-way street with benefits for recruiting and the mobility of seasoned engineers, says Raytheon\u2019s Raul Almazan, who is an engineering technical leadership development lead at the aerospace and defense company. As a key corporate partner with the EP program in systems engineering, Raytheon selects annual cohorts of 20 to 24 employees to enter Johns Hopkins\u2019 Master\u2019s in Systems Engineering program, Almazan notes.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p>Raytheon\u2019s collaboration with the EP program \u201cis built upon our own priorities,\u201d he says. It has become a key element both in the company\u2019s success in recruiting talent, as well as in creating \u201ca mobility ladder for all of our employees who are in the cohorts.\u201d Raytheon has graduated over 500 people through the EP program.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p>\u201cIt\u2019s been a great opportunity to accelerate career development and talent pipelines,\u201d says Almazan.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<blockquote class=\"wp-block-quote is-layout-flow wp-block-quote-is-layout-flow\">\n<p>\u201cThe program chairs do a magnificent job of surveying industry, identifying critical needs, and building coursework to help Engineering for Professionals students meet those needs.\u201d \u2014 Dan Horn<\/p>\n<\/blockquote>\n\n\n\n<h2 class=\"gb-text\">Team Learning<\/h2>\n\n\n\n<p>Successful online education requires active shepherding of enrolled students\u2014especially the widely scattered cohorts that take challenging courses in addition to navigating their busy working lives. So Ramirez designed the class to have multiple checkpoints to assess progress. He also encourages students to create teams to provide each other with a steady stream of peer feedback.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p>Heines says that it was a highly effective tactic: \u201cMy team was a team of three, because there were three of us on the West Coast, so it made sense from a time zone perspective.\u201d The safety net offered stability and structure for the experience. \u201cThere was only so far that you would stumble before you had an obvious check-in point where Juan, or somebody else, could help you,\u201d he says.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p>Clancy says he enjoyed the opportunity that Applications of Power Electronics Design provided to \u201capply theory to actual application. A lot of time, theory gets applied to simulation\u2014and simulation doesn\u2019t always actually model the real world.\u201d<\/p>\n\n\n\n<blockquote class=\"wp-block-quote has-text-align-left is-layout-flow wp-block-quote-is-layout-flow\">\n<p>\u201c[The program] applies theory to actual application. Some students have taken previous coursework and learned the fundamentals but never really had to put that all into practice. This is an opportunity for them to build something that actually works.\u201d<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p>Heines says that he held onto the board he made for his final project in 2023 and keeps it close at hand. \u201cI\u2019ve shown this to people on job interviews since that class has ended,\u201d he continues. \u201c[Interviewers] always want to know:\u2019 \u2018What have you done?\u2019 You can hold up the board and say: \u2018I built this, and it works.\u2019 It really does give you that sense of pride and accomplishment.\u201d<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p><\/p>\n","protected":false},"excerpt":{"rendered":"<p>For engineers working in rapidly changing industries, the Engineering for Professionals program offers responsive coursework that keeps them on the cutting edge.<\/p>\n","protected":false},"author":3,"featured_media":55088,"comment_status":"closed","ping_status":"closed","sticky":false,"template":"","format":"standard","meta":{"_acf_changed":false,"footnotes":""},"categories":[32],"tags":[],"issue":[104],"class_list":["post-55082","post","type-post","status-publish","format-standard","has-post-thumbnail","hentry","category-inquiring-minds","issue-fall-2025"],"acf":[],"yoast_head":"<!-- This site is optimized with the Yoast SEO plugin v27.9 -
